# Barcode scanner
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
When the user has the correct permission there will be a barcode scanner button in the navbar.
|
|
||||||
On this page you can either input a barcode code by hand, use an external barcode scanner, or use your devices camera to
|
|
||||||
scan a barcode.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
In info mode (when the "Info" toggle is enabled) you can scan a barcode and Part-DB will parse it and show information
|
|
||||||
about it.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Without info mode, the barcode will directly redirect you to the corresponding page.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
### Barcode matching
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
When you scan a barcode, Part-DB will try to match it to an existing part, part lot or storage location first.
|
|
||||||
For Part-DB generated barcodes, it will use the internal ID of a part. Alternatively you can also scan a barcode that contains the part's IPN.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
You can set a GTIN/EAN code in the part properties and Part-DB will open the part page when you scan the corresponding GTIN/EAN barcode.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
On a part lot you can under "Advanced" set a user barcode, that will redirect you to the part lot page when scanned. This allows to reuse
|
|
||||||
arbitrary existing barcodes that already exist on the part lots (for example, from the manufacturer) and link them to the part lot in Part-DB.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Part-DB can also parse various distributor barcodes (for example from Digikey and Mouser) and will try to redirect you to the corresponding
|
|
||||||
part page based on the distributor part number in the barcode.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
### Part creation from barcodes
|
|
||||||
For certain barcodes Part-DB can automatically create a new part, when it cannot find a matching part.
|
|
||||||
Part-DB will try to retrieve the part information from an information provider and redirects you to the part creation page
|
|
||||||
with the retrieved information pre-filled.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
## Using an external barcode scanner
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Part-DB supports the use of external barcode scanners that emulate keyboard input. To use a barcode scanner with Part-DB,
|
|
||||||
simply connect the scanner to your computer and scan a barcode while the cursor is in a text field in Part-DB.
|
|
||||||
The scanned barcode will be entered into the text field as if you had typed it on the keyboard.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
In scanner fields, it will also try to insert special non-printable characters the scanner send via Alt + key combinations.
|
|
||||||
This is required for EIGP114 datamatrix codes.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
### Automatically redirect on barcode scanning
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
If you configure your barcode scanner to send a <SOH> (Start of heading, 0x01) non-printable character at the beginning
|
|
||||||
of the scanned barcode, Part-DB will automatically scan the barcode that comes afterward (and is ended with an enter key)
|
|
||||||
and redirects you to the corresponding page.
|
|
||||||
This allows you to quickly scan a barcode from anywhere in Part-DB without the need to first open the scanner page.
|
|
||||||
If an input field is focused, the barcode will be entered into the field as usual and no redirection will happen.
